Finding a Psychiatrist

It can be difficult to pick the right psychiatrist, but it is crucial for your mental health. The best place to begin is with a referral from your primary care physician, who can suggest a specialist in accordance with their experiences. You can also request recommendations from your family and friends who have had therapy. Some community agencies and private insurance providers offer lists of mental health specialists.

Do some research on their credentials and their background. Find out how long they have been practicing, if they have board certification, and what kind of patients they treat. You should also think about their office location, hours of operation and other aspects that matter to you. If you prefer online-only treatments, for example, search for psychiatrists that offer this option.

It is also important to consider the kind of psychiatrist you're looking for. You might need an expert psychiatrist in the condition that causes your issues or has worked with patients who are similar in age or gender. You should also think about what kind of personality you're comfortable with and your preferred style of communication and preferences.

Contact the psychiatrist's office prior to making your appointment to make sure they accept insurance. If they don't, it might be a better idea choose a different doctor. Also, be sure you record your medical history and bring any relevant documents you have. This will allow the psychiatrist to examine your situation and decide on a treatment plan for you.

In the initial session, you will likely discuss your concerns or questions regarding your mental wellbeing. Based on the symptoms you're experiencing you may be prescribed medication or given alternative treatment options. Based on the treatment plan, you may have to schedule regular visits to the doctor for regular appointments or to check your progress.

Although finding a psychiatrist may take some time, it's worth the effort to find one that best meets your needs. Finding a Psychiatrist Referral

It is crucial to seek treatment if you suffer from a mental health assessments near me illness, such as bipolar disorder, or anxiety. A psychiatrist can help you deal with the symptoms and improve the quality of your life. You'll require a referral from your doctor before seeing one. A Psychiatrist Referral is an official document that allows you to visit an expert psychiatrist for a diagnosis evaluation. This can include a psychiatric examination, psychological questionnaires and even blood tests.

The process for obtaining an appointment with a psychiatrist begins by scheduling an appointment with your general doctor or primary care physician. The GP will determine if they think you need a specialist referral. Most doctors will refer patients to specialists when they believe it is necessary. The GP will also work to rule out possible medical reasons for your symptoms, such as an unbalanced thyroid.

A psychiatric assessment will evaluate every aspect of your life, including your mood and behavior, as well as how well you think and reason, as well as how well you remember things. The psychiatric evaluation will also examine the way you interact with other people and your family. This information will be used by the psychiatrist to determine the condition of you and recommend treatment options.

How to Get an appointment with a psychiatrist

A psychiatrist appointment is a vital step in the treatment of assess your mental health mental health. It is essential to select a doctor who will be easy to talk with and who has experience treating your specific symptoms. You can also check online reviews of psychiatrists in your area to learn more about their treatment methods. If you see a lot of negative reviews, it's best to look for another psychiatrist.

Bring a friend or a family member along if are nervous. They can offer emotional support and help you remember what the psychiatrist said. In addition, they can help you fill out paperwork and sort out payment details. You should also consult your insurance provider to make sure that your visit will be covered.

It is recommended to schedule your first appointment when you are able to focus on the conversation. Bring pen and pad to write down any instructions from your doctor. In the initial appointment, your psychiatrist will take some basic details about you, including your contact details and medical history. Your temperature and blood pressure could also be measured. They may ask you about your current symptoms and the impact on your daily routine. They will then recommend an appropriate treatment plan. If you decide to use medication, your psychiatrist will explain the benefits and side effects of various medications. In most cases, it takes trial and error to determine the appropriate medication for you.
